Tusshar Kapoor |
His debut was as any another actor's son but by now he has made his ground in the tinsel town. Initially, he started as an actor who is good in dancing, but today he's also accepted as an actor of merit. He has not one, but four films scheduled to release in the coming months. The first among these four is Babloo Pachisia's 'Kya Love Story Hai', directed by debutante Lovely Singh, which releases this week. Bollyvista chats with Tusshar Kapoor.
Tell us some thing about your next release 'Kya Love Story Hai'.
Apart from the fact that it's not the run-of-the-mill subject, I can tell you that its been a long time sine any youth oriented film has been released. So, this film is going to be a refreshing change for the audience. The film is about Arjun, Kajal and Ranvir. I play Arjun, a normal guy just out of the college. He is not a Casanova but then he takes things too easy. Since he belongs to a very rich family, he takes things very lightly. Until one day when he meets Kajal. The meeting changes him a lot and there is a lot of twist and turns in the story thereafter.
You must be nervous since it's your solo venture...
Of course! Strangely, I'm going to have four back-to-back releases in the coming months. Luckily, each one of them is different from the another; all different genres from comedy to action to emotion. Also, I can't plan my own release date. It's the producers who decide according to their plans and conveniences. Maybe they all want to encash the holiday period which is I guess a smart movie.
So, what's the USP of 'Kya Love Story Hai'?
As I said, the USP is the freshness. It's completely something new, and in the way it has been treated, Lovely Singh, the director has done a commendable job. It's a youth oriented film, but not 'Mujhe Kucch Kehna Hai'. My first film was a college campus love story. However, this one is a little mature love story blended with lovely songs.
